Remove Continuous Deployment Remove Document Remove Management Remove Product Development
article thumbnail

Why Continuous Deployment?

Startup Lessons Learned

Lessons Learned by Eric Ries Monday, June 15, 2009 Why Continuous Deployment? Of all the tactics I have advocated as part of the lean startup , none has provoked as many extreme reactions as continuous deployment , a process that allows companies to release software in minutes instead of days, weeks, or months.

article thumbnail

Lessons Learned: The engineering manager's lament

Startup Lessons Learned

Lessons Learned by Eric Ries Monday, October 20, 2008 The engineering managers lament I was inspired to write The product managers lament while meeting with a startup struggling to figure out what had gone wrong with their product development process. This engineering manager is a smart guy, and very experienced.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

The cardinal sin of community management

Startup Lessons Learned

Lessons Learned by Eric Ries Friday, September 11, 2009 The cardinal sin of community management Once you have a product launched, you will the face the joys – and the despair – of a community that grows up around it. This probably sounds illogical. We were totally unprepared for the magnitude of what happened.

Community 158
article thumbnail

Lean Startup at Scale

Startup Lessons Learned

This finally bit us after a four month stint of development blew through its testing schedule by a factor of four: two scheduled weeks turned into two months before the product reached stability. Software development is all about managing complexity and the bigger and more mature the codebase gets, the more complex it gets.

Lean 167
article thumbnail

Lessons Learned: Five Whys

Startup Lessons Learned

Now, everyone is learning together - about your product, process, and team. Each five whys email is a teaching document. We had made so many improvements to our tools and processes for deployment, that it was pretty hard to take the site down. Case Study: Continuous deployment makes releases n.

article thumbnail

Lessons Learned: Stevey's Blog Rants: Good Agile, Bad Agile

Startup Lessons Learned

They take things like unit testing, design documents and code reviews more seriously than any other company Ive even heard about. Case Study: Continuous deployment makes releases n. Amazing lean startup resources Is Entrepreneurship a Management Science? So launches become an emergent property of the system.

Agile 76
article thumbnail

Lessons Learned: Ideas. Code. Data. Implement. Measure. Learn

Startup Lessons Learned

Its inspired by the classic OODA Loop and is really just a simplified version of that concept, applied specifically to creating a software product development team. There are three stages: We start with ideas about what our product could be. How about documentation that nobody reads? the data on a regular basis.